Engine Oil Level
Maintaining the correct engine oil level is paramount for proper lubrication. Insufficient oil leads to increased friction, overheating, and accelerated wear. Overfilling, conversely, can result in oil aeration and damage to seals. The service schedule dictates precise oil level checks to ensure optimal lubrication, preventing potential engine damage. Coolant Level
The coolant system regulates engine temperature, preventing overheating and freezing. Low coolant levels can lead to engine damage, while contaminated coolant compromises its heat transfer capabilities. The service schedule prescribes regular coolant level inspections and periodic flushes to maintain optimal temperature control. Brake Fluid Level
Adequate brake fluid is essential for safe and effective braking. Low levels can indicate leaks or worn brake components, potentially leading to diminished braking performance or complete brake failure. The service schedule mandates routine brake fluid level inspections, ensuring responsive and reliable stopping power. Consider an F-150 used for towing a recreational trailer. Transmission Fluid Level
Proper transmission fluid level and condition are crucial for smooth shifting and transmission longevity. Low fluid levels can cause slippage, overheating, and transmission damage. The service schedule specifies regular transmission fluid level checks and periodic fluid changes to ensure optimal transmission performance. 7. Belt and Hose Assessment
The 2019 Ford F-150 service schedule dedicates attention to belt and hose assessment, reflecting an understanding of these components’ vital, yet often overlooked, role. Picture a family embarking on a cross-country road trip in their F-150. The engine belts, responsible for powering critical accessories like the alternator, water pump, and air conditioning compressor, silently endure thousands of rotations per minute. Similarly, the hoses, conduits for coolant and other essential fluids, withstand constant pressure and temperature fluctuations. The service schedule recognizes that these components, made of rubber and other perishable materials, inevitably degrade over time, a process accelerated by heat, stress, and environmental factors. Ignoring their condition can lead to sudden failure, disrupting the vehicle’s operation and potentially causing more extensive damage.
Consider the potential ramifications of a broken serpentine belt during the family’s road trip. The alternator, deprived of power, ceases to charge the battery, leading to electrical system failure. The water pump, no longer circulating coolant, causes the engine to overheat, potentially resulting in a blown head gasket or other catastrophic damage. The air conditioning system shuts down, leaving the family sweltering in the summer heat. These cascading failures, all stemming from a neglected belt, highlight the importance of the service schedule’s emphasis on belt and hose assessment. A routine inspection, as prescribed by the schedule, could reveal cracks, wear, or other signs of impending failure, allowing for timely replacement and preventing the aforementioned scenario. Tip 1: Understand the “Severe Duty” Clause: The service schedule contains fine print regarding “severe duty” conditions frequent towing, off-road driving, or prolonged idling. A rancher hauling heavy loads across uneven fields operates under severe duty. Their maintenance intervals should be significantly shorter than a commuter vehicle traversing smooth highways.
Tip 2: Embrace Synthetic Oil: While conventional oil meets the minimum requirements, synthetic oil offers superior protection, especially in extreme temperatures. A construction worker operating in the desert heat benefits greatly from the enhanced lubrication and cooling properties of synthetic oil.
Tip 3: Monitor Fluid Levels Regularly: Don’t wait for the scheduled service interval to check fluid levels. A quick visual inspection of engine oil, coolant, brake fluid, and transmission fluid can reveal leaks or other problems early on. This quick check can be done at any point in time with minimum time.
Tip 4: Use OEM Filters: Aftermarket filters may seem like a cost-effective alternative, but they often lack the quality and filtration efficiency of Original Equipment Manufacturer (OEM) filters.
